This opportunity is being offered by National Aerospace Solutions, the team selected by the U.S. Air Force to conduct Test and Operations Sustainment at the Arnold Engineering Development Complex (AEDC). National Aerospace Solutions is a limited liability company comprised of Bechtel National Inc. (as lead company) and Sierra Lobo Inc. with teaming Subcontractors nLogic Inc. and Chugach Federal Solutions Inc.

Work will be performed at the AEDC Hypervelocity Wind Tunnel No. 9 (Tunnel 9) located in Silver Spring, Maryland. Tunnel 9 provides aerodynamic simulation critical to hypersonic system development and hypersonic vehicle technologies at speeds from Mach 7 to Mach 18, a capability unmatched anywhere in the United States

Job Summary:
The Senior Electrical Engineer will provide oversite of a small team of electrical engineers and technicians responsible for the facility data and instrumentation system, control system and electrical distribution system required to operate a wind tunnel facility. The team lead is responsible for providing technical direction to a team of electrical engineers, coordinating electrical work with facility project schedules, reporting technical/financial status of projects to management, and ensuring safe and reliable operation of electrical all subsystems.
